Be the difference in others recovery journeys with Recovery Corps. As someone who knows what its like to build a healthy life in recovery you can help make recovery possible for more people!
Join Recovery Corps as a Recovery Navigator and youll spend your days at an organization committed to serving recovery communities. Well train you to provide peer support to individuals as they work to maintain their progress in recovery.
How does it work Youll meet with participants and provide guidance as they navigate resources set goals and develop recovery action plans. Through individualized support youll be part of creating more success stories!

About Our Organization
Recovery Corps is powered by AmeriCorps members helping more people build a healthy life in recovery. The program launched in 2017 as a strategic partnership through ServeMinnesota and is administered by Ampact as part of its healthy futures program offerings.
